How much does a brunch venue cost to rent in Dallas?

Brunch venues in Dallas average $134 per hour to rent, but it’s easy to spend less or more depending on what you’re looking for. For a space on the smaller side, expect to spend closer to $189, whereas larger venues run about $432 per hour.

What's the best day to rent a brunch venue in Dallas?

Saturdays are the most popular day for booking brunch venues in Dallas. For those seeking a deal, consider booking Wednesday and Sunday as these days are 9% cheaper on average.

How popular are brunch venues in Dallas?

Our local hosts have welcomed 6275 people into their brunch venues with reviews averaging 4.97 stars. 100% of guests said they'd book again.

How long do people rent brunch venues in Dallas?

Most brunch venues are scheduled for 6 hours, with 51 people in attendance. You’ll find the most Brunches starting between 2:00 PM and 3:00 PM.

Book a space for brunch in Dallas

Brunch parties are a fun way to celebrate, get together with friends, and enjoy food selections from both the breakfast and lunch menu. Corporate brunches, bachelorette parties, engagement parties, and family reunions are just a few events that can be celebrated during brunch. Brunch time is usually around 9-10 am, right in between the breakfast and lunch hours. They are often held on weekends since a 9-5 work schedule makes a brunch party more difficult to arrange. Brunch venues in Dallas come in many sizes and styles. Not to mention the menu options you can choose from. Some of our favorite brunch venues offer French, New American, and Tex-Mex cuisine. Breakfast burritos, waffles, sausage links, croissants... What does your ideal brunch selection look like? Southern comfort food like biscuits and gravy are a popular choice. Comfort food brings to life fond memories of Mom's kitchen. So why not try a downtown brunch venue like Ellen's on Record Street?

Spacious brunch venues in Dallas

Brunch restaurants are beautifully decorated and include savory items. But for a larger brunch party there may not be enough space for your guest list. Spacious locations for brunch in Dallas include banquet halls like the 2616 Commerce Event Center. Located downtown, this multilevel industrial chic venue offers space for large brunches. You can enjoy good company and fine dining outside or indoors. The outdoor deck is our recommendation as the Dallas skyline views are unbeatable. Larger brunch venues offer extra seating, enclosed patios, and live music. Buffet style catering is an easier way to ensure everyone gets enough food. And the space provided by a large venue means your guests won't feel too crowded by the tables and trays of food.

Private brunch locations in Dallas

Restaurants like Mercat Bistro and Ellen's offer fantastic cuisine in a beautiful space. But long wait times and crowded seating arrangements are to be expected if you don't coordinate your brunch party with the venue staff. Instead of hoping for the best, you're better off hosting a private brunch at your chosen venue. When you rent space for brunch in Dallas your guests will enjoy a meal and company in a private room set off from the main dining hall. Or you could rent the entire restaurant, dining hall, or party venue for your event. Securing the whole venue is ideal if you have a wedding party or large family reunion brunch to celebrate. But even for more intimate brunch parties a private space has a lot of value. Conversations are easy to hold and you'll have undivided attention of your serving and catering staff.
